You'd want to find a way to LAX that reliably avoids the Sepulveda exit from the 105-- it's been very inconsistent lately and there have been a few times where the mile or so from the line to exit there to T1 was the longest part of my trip to LAX, and I'm coming from just north of Pasadena.

Transcon commuting can get old- for a couple years I was going LAX-IAD about once a month (generally 2-3 days on the ground, sometimes a week). A few times I had to do the RT with only a few days on the ground back at home, and those weren't a lot of fun. It was made worse by my day job usually being a commute Pasadena to Manhattan Beach (which is a horrible commute) and a lot of the trips to IAD on short notice over weekends. Another former poster here was commuting every week transcon across Canada, and it showed...it was clearly pretty hard on him, even when he didn't think so.
